In-House Commercial Contracting Attorney (Full-Time, Hybrid – Nashville, TN, Contract Engagement). Are you a seasoned business attorney with a strong background in commercial contracting? Latitude is partnering with one of Nashville’s premier corporate legal departments to recruit a full-time, in-house Corporate Attorney on an engagement basis. In this role, you’ll take the lead on a wide range of commercial contracting matters, including reviewing, negotiating, and drafting agreements such as NDAs, MSAs, customer agreements, and IT and technology licenses. You’ll also work closely with business stakeholders, providing practical, business-focused guidance on contract-related issues that impact day-to-day operations. Experience with SaaS and technology-driven contracts is a plus. The ideal candidate will have 8+ years of experience advising business clients on commercial contracts and will be comfortable serving as a trusted legal partner to internal teams. This opportunity is well-suited for attorneys seeking to transition into an in-house environment while building strong relationships within a sophisticated and well-regarded corporate legal team. The position is hybrid, with three days onsite at the client’s Nashville offices and two days remote. Candidates must be based in the Nashville, TN area and available to work a hybrid schedule.
Responsibilities
Reviewing, negotiating, and drafting commercial agreements, including NDAs, MSAs, customer agreements, and IT licenses.
Provide practical, business-focused guidance on contract issues that impact day-to-day operations.
Collaborate with business stakeholders to support commercial objectives in a compliant manner.
Serve as a trusted legal partner to internal teams in a fast-paced environment.
Qualifications
8+ years of contracting experience.
Extensive experience reviewing, negotiating, and drafting NDAs, MSAs, customer agreements, and IT licenses.
Broad-based experience counseling businesses on a wide range of issues.
J.D. from an ABA-accredited law school with excellent academic credentials.
Impeccable time-management, attention to detail, professional judgment, and communication skills.
Licensed to practice law in Tennessee (in-house) and in good standing.
Strong professional references.
